Output 668789a80fafe7e075531b9f090c8cd37b618deff39fcba4051b613222ba7e16:267

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2cca637609103acb6e8099fed38bb1f4842a93813f0cfd95c62acd785b4b045c
address
bc1p9n9xxasfzqavkm5qn8ld8za37jzz4yup8ux0m9wx9txhsk6tq3wqfv59es
transaction
668789a80fafe7e075531b9f090c8cd37b618deff39fcba4051b613222ba7e16
confirmations
9849
spent
true